_USBD_DevClassHandleTypeDef::classId is only used within Ux_Device_HID_CDC_ACM.
 
Symbols
loading...
Files
loading...

_USBD_DevClassHandleTypeDef::classId field

Syntax

uint32_t classId;

References

LocationReferrerText
ux_device_descriptors.h:99
uint32_t classId;
ux_device_descriptors.c:439USBD_Device_Framework_Builder()
if ((pdev->classId < USBD_MAX_SUPPORTED_CLASS) &&
ux_device_descriptors.c:448USBD_Device_Framework_Builder()
pdev->classId ++;
ux_device_descriptors.c:494USBD_FrameWork_AddClass()
if ((pdev->classId < USBD_MAX_SUPPORTED_CLASS) &&
ux_device_descriptors.c:495USBD_FrameWork_AddClass()
(pdev->tclasslist[pdev->classId].Active == 0U))
ux_device_descriptors.c:498USBD_FrameWork_AddClass()
pdev->tclasslist[pdev->classId].ClassId = pdev->classId;
ux_device_descriptors.c:499USBD_FrameWork_AddClass()
pdev->tclasslist[pdev->classId].Active = 1U;
ux_device_descriptors.c:500USBD_FrameWork_AddClass()
pdev->tclasslist[pdev->classId].ClassType = class;
ux_device_descriptors.c:533USBD_FrameWork_AddToConfDesc()
if (pdev->classId == 0U)
ux_device_descriptors.c:539USBD_FrameWork_AddToConfDesc()
switch (pdev->tclasslist[pdev->classId].ClassType)
ux_device_descriptors.c:546USBD_FrameWork_AddToConfDesc()
pdev->tclasslist[pdev->classId].NumIf = 1U;
ux_device_descriptors.c:547USBD_FrameWork_AddToConfDesc()
pdev->tclasslist[pdev->classId].Ifs[0] = interface;
ux_device_descriptors.c:550USBD_FrameWork_AddToConfDesc()
pdev->tclasslist[pdev->classId].NumEps = 1U; /* EP1_IN */
ux_device_descriptors.c:577USBD_FrameWork_AddToConfDesc()
pdev->tclasslist[pdev->classId].NumIf = 2U;
ux_device_descriptors.c:578USBD_FrameWork_AddToConfDesc()
pdev->tclasslist[pdev->classId].Ifs[0] = interface;
ux_device_descriptors.c:579USBD_FrameWork_AddToConfDesc()
pdev->tclasslist[pdev->classId].Ifs[1] = (uint8_t)(interface + 1U);
ux_device_descriptors.c:582USBD_FrameWork_AddToConfDesc()
pdev->tclasslist[pdev->classId].NumEps = 3U;
ux_device_descriptors.c:696USBD_FrameWork_AssignEp()
while (((idx < (pdev->tclasslist[pdev->classId]).NumEps) && \
ux_device_descriptors.c:697USBD_FrameWork_AssignEp()
((pdev->tclasslist[pdev->classId].Eps[idx].is_used) != 0U)))
ux_device_descriptors.c:704USBD_FrameWork_AssignEp()
pdev->tclasslist[pdev->classId].Eps[idx].add = Add;
ux_device_descriptors.c:705USBD_FrameWork_AssignEp()
pdev->tclasslist[pdev->classId].Eps[idx].type = Type;
ux_device_descriptors.c:706USBD_FrameWork_AssignEp()
pdev->tclasslist[pdev->classId].Eps[idx].size = (uint16_t) Sze;
ux_device_descriptors.c:707USBD_FrameWork_AssignEp()
pdev->tclasslist[pdev->classId].Eps[idx].is_used = 1U;
ux_device_descriptors.c:727USBD_FrameWork_HID_Desc()
ux_device_descriptors.c:728USBD_FrameWork_HID_Desc()
(uint8_t)(pdev->tclasslist[pdev->classId].NumEps),
ux_device_descriptors.c:745USBD_FrameWork_HID_Desc()
ux_device_descriptors.c:747USBD_FrameWork_HID_Desc()
(uint16_t)pdev->tclasslist[pdev->classId].Eps[0].size,
ux_device_descriptors.c:753USBD_FrameWork_HID_Desc()
ux_device_descriptors.c:755USBD_FrameWork_HID_Desc()
(uint16_t)pdev->tclasslist[pdev->classId].Eps[0].size,
ux_device_descriptors.c:792USBD_FrameWork_CDCDesc()
pIadDesc->bFirstInterface = pdev->tclasslist[pdev->classId].Ifs[0];
ux_device_descriptors.c:802USBD_FrameWork_CDCDesc()
__USBD_FRAMEWORK_SET_IF(pdev->tclasslist[pdev->classId].Ifs[0], 0U, 1U, 0x02,
ux_device_descriptors.c:820USBD_FrameWork_CDCDesc()
pCallMgmDesc->bDataInterface = pdev->tclasslist[pdev->classId].Ifs[1];
ux_device_descriptors.c:836USBD_FrameWork_CDCDesc()
pUnionDesc->bMasterInterface = pdev->tclasslist[pdev->classId].Ifs[0];
ux_device_descriptors.c:837USBD_FrameWork_CDCDesc()
pUnionDesc->bSlaveInterface = pdev->tclasslist[pdev->classId].Ifs[1];
ux_device_descriptors.c:841USBD_FrameWork_CDCDesc()
ux_device_descriptors.c:843USBD_FrameWork_CDCDesc()
(uint16_t)pdev->tclasslist[pdev->classId].Eps[2].size,
ux_device_descriptors.c:848USBD_FrameWork_CDCDesc()
__USBD_FRAMEWORK_SET_IF(pdev->tclasslist[pdev->classId].Ifs[1], 0U, 2U, 0x0A,
ux_device_descriptors.c:852USBD_FrameWork_CDCDesc()
ux_device_descriptors.c:854USBD_FrameWork_CDCDesc()
(uint16_t)(pdev->tclasslist[pdev->classId].Eps[0].size),
ux_device_descriptors.c:858USBD_FrameWork_CDCDesc()
ux_device_descriptors.c:860USBD_FrameWork_CDCDesc()
(uint16_t)(pdev->tclasslist[pdev->classId].Eps[1].size),

Data Use

Functions writing _USBD_DevClassHandleTypeDef::classId
Functions reading _USBD_DevClassHandleTypeDef::classId
all items filtered out
_USBD_DevClassHandleTypeDef::classId
Type of _USBD_DevClassHandleTypeDef::classId
_USBD_DevClassHandleTypeDef::classId
uint32_t
all items filtered out